Ardabil County (fa|شهرستان اردبیل) is in Ardabil province, Iran. Its capital is the city of Ardabil.[2]
History
After the 2006 National Census, Sareyn District was separated from the county in the establishment of Sareyn County.[3] Gharbi Rural District was separated from the Central District in the formation of Samarin District, to include the new Dujaq Rural District.[4]
After the 2016 census, the village of Aralluy-e Bozorg merged with another village to form the new city of Arallu,[5] and the village of Samarin was elevated to the status of a city.[6]
Demographics
Population
At the time of the 2006 census, the county's population was 542,930 in 131,950 households.[7] The following census in 2011 counted 564,365 people in 156,242 households.[8] The 2016 census measured the population of the county as 605,992 in 180,975 households.[9]
